Transaction 59bdf52aeb5a14df3c6bc1ea0bfe5712d8e70b586bbe495b7066fdc708497a8d
1 Input
1 Output
-
59bdf52aeb5a14df3c6bc1ea0bfe5712d8e70b586bbe495b7066fdc708497a8d:0
- value
- 1630429
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 743bbc327cff88b8fd87ab469b1781e0d278c9cd OP_EQUAL
- address
- 3CHbsGRbAPVaP1T29GEM9Lyg18SBqdMAB2